当前位置:编程学习 > JAVA >>

【新人】关于二维动态数组!

本人今天用java连接数据库然后查询
想把查询结果保存到数组中
忽然发现没法声明数组
因为可能不知道数据库中有多少条记录
so
问问怎么定义动态数组?! --------------------编程问答-------------------- 数组不能动态的初始化,定义数组的时候必须指定长度,或者赋值来确定长度。

可以用一个List<List<String>> 可以实现2维数组的任何功能 --------------------编程问答-------------------- 你可以在查询出来得到记录的个数之后再初始化数组。

或者用ArrayList。 --------------------编程问答--------------------
引用 2 楼 huxiweng 的回复:
你可以在查询出来得到记录的个数之后再初始化数组。

或者用ArrayList。
+1 --------------------编程问答-------------------- 嗯,已经用ArrayList了 --------------------编程问答-------------------- 推荐楼主用ArrayList,能够动态添加。。。。

另外楼主签名霸气。。。。
补充:Java ,  Web 开发
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,